Why Daily Mood Tracking Matters
- Recognize emotional patterns you might not be aware of
- Understand how seasons, routines, or life events affect your mood
- Have concrete data to share with a therapist or counselor
- Build self-awareness through consistent daily reflection
- Notice when something needs to change before it becomes a bigger issue
